    The Aga Khan Academy Nairobi is operated by Aga Khan Education Service Kenya (AKESK), a non-profit organization, with close to a hundred years’ experience operating schools in Kenya. Our first formal schools were opened in 1918, and AKESK currently operates 11 schools in Nairobi, Mombasa, Kisumu and Eldoret, serving close to 5,000 students with a quali...

    Deputy Head Teacher, Middle School

    The position

    The Deputy Head Teacher (Middle School) will report to the Senior School Head Teacher and work closely with the Senior Leadership Team, department heads, and other staff in ensuring that the highest standards of teaching and learning are practiced throughout the school, with a key focus on the Middle Years Programme (IBMYP, Grades 6 to 8), and in line with the school’s strategic plan.

    S/he takes on a suitable teaching allocation, has a profound understanding of the needs of students in the relevant age group and the IB Middle Years Programme, ensures the provision of adequate pastoral support for students and is a collaborative, passionate, globally-minded individual with excellent organizational and time-management skills. S/he is able to set and fulfill the highest standards and expectations, is self-motivated, and enthusiastic about the development of students in Grades 6 to 8. S/he possesses excellent interpersonal and communication skills with a sincere commitment to contribute to the work of the Senior Leadership Team.

    Key Responsibilities

    Deputy Head Teacher (Middle School)

    • Supports the Head of Senior School and provides effective leadership in the development and successful implementation structures and processes that support IBMYP students, especially in grades 6 to 8
    • Contributes to the production of a timetable that meets the learning needs of students and the requirements of the MYP
    • Ensures adequate pastoral support for students in grades 6 to 8
    • Role-models best practices in teaching and learning
    • Monitors assessment, reporting and data management
    • Contributes to staff performance management, School Policy development and implementation, ongoing professional development and staff recruitment

    The requirements

    Qualifications and Experience

    • Bachelor’s degree in Education (B.Ed.)
    • 5 years of IB Middle Years’ Programme and/or IB Diploma outstanding teaching experience as well as previous Middle Years’ Programme and/or IB Diploma leadership experience in an IB World School
    • Teachers Service Commission Certification

    Nurse, Mombasa Schools

    The position

    To provide school health services, which include health screening, treatment of minor ailments, coordinating referrals to medical providers, spearheading the promotion of health, and provision of the safe school environment for staff and students.

    Key Responsibilities

    • Implementing the relevant school health policies and guidelines paying attention to the relevant school and public health laws and regulations
    • Carry out all duties to nursing and first aid applications
    • Serves as the expert in the school to meet student health needs, with an understanding of normal growth and development in children, as well as children with special health needs
    • Monitors disease outbreak amongst children and institutes infection control measures to prevent the spread
    • Is responsible to assess the school environment for the safety of children and provides the necessary advice to school administration about potential risks
    • Takes lead in health promotion and screening programs in the school, and is conversant with referral procedures to health providers
    • The school nurse serves as a liaison between school personnel, family, community, and health care providers to advocate for health care and a healthy school environment

    The requirements

    Qualifications and Experience

    • Nursing Diploma or Equivalent from a recognized school of nursing or University
    • 3 -5 year of related experience preferred in a school setting
    • Current licensure with the Nursing Council of Kenya
    • Certification in the basic life support (BLS)

    Head Teacher, Aga Khan Academy Junior School

    The position

    The Head Teacher will be responsible for the pedagogical and administrative management of Aga Khan Academy, Nairobi – Junior School, provision of high-quality education and support the school’s positioning as an IB World School of Excellence in Nairobi and as an integral part of the Academy.

    S/he will drive the academic and extra-curricular programmes of the school, provide leadership for the students and staff, monitor performance against targets and quality indicators, and oversee day-to-day operations of the school.

    Key responsibilities

    • In consultation with the AKES,K Leadership team, develop annual objectives, school development plan, and quality indicators that ensure delivery of a relevant, high-quality education
    • Monitor school, staff, and student performance conduct a school self-evaluation and provide senior leaders with regular reports on progress achieved against strategic and operational goals
    • Strengthen the implementation and continued performance and success of the IBO-PYP curriculum and monitor the PYP action plan, enabling AKJAN to become a model school in the implementation of this curriculum
    • Ensure that appropriate systems are in place to meet and maintain authorisation requirements for the IBO.  Where required, ensure plans for CIS accreditation are developed, tracked and target dates met
    • Ensure systems are in place for tracking individual students and their progress through the school year and through the school, identify areas where students need additional support to ensure “no child is left behind”
    • Build a high-performance team, committed to achieving the vision of the school
    • Manage the budget, resources and assets of the school, and ensure that all school funds are appropriately allocated and administered as specified in the school’s financial plan

    The requirements

    Qualifications and Experience

    • Bachelor’s Degree in Education/ a post-graduate degree in Education from an accredited university, with qualifications in IB Primary Years Programme Teaching and Teacher Service Commission registration
    • At least five years’ experience in international curriculum schools, including experience in the International Baccalaureate system and at least two years as head of a primary school
    • Good understanding of, and experience in curriculum management, design, implementation and evaluation
    • Understanding of 21st century education practices, strategies for raising students’ achievement and effective frameworks for school improvement planning and self-evaluation
    • Experience in the developing world and in Africa will be highly desirable
